Which countries now have visa-free access to China?
China has expanded visa-free entry to 74 countries, including many from Europe, Asia, and the Americas. Over 20 million visitors entered China without visas in 2024, thanks to these new policies. The list includes countries like Japan, South Korea, Australia, and several European nations, making travel to China more accessible for many international tourists.

How is China trying to revive tourism after the pandemic?
China is implementing measures such as expanding visa-free travel, easing duty-free shopping rules, and simplifying entry procedures to attract more visitors. These efforts are part of a broader strategy to recover from pandemic setbacks, boost local economies, and promote cultural exchange. Tourist numbers are already rising, especially in major cities like Shanghai and Beijing.

What are the challenges in digital payments and marketing for tourists?
Despite easing travel restrictions, tourists face hurdles with digital payments due to internet restrictions and limited access to global platforms. Marketing efforts are also ongoing to better target international visitors and improve their experience. Overcoming these challenges is key to sustaining the tourism boom and ensuring visitors can enjoy seamless transactions.
